Interior door trim repair services involve restoring or replacing the decorative moldings and framing that surround interior doors. Over time, door trim can become damaged due to impacts, everyday wear, or shifts in the building structure. Skilled service providers can fix issues such as cracked, chipped, or loose trim, ensuring that the appearance and function of interior doors are maintained. This work often includes filling in gaps, sanding, repainting, or replacing sections of trim to achieve a seamless look that complements the surrounding decor.
Many problems can signal the need for door trim repair. Common issues include visible cracks or splits in the molding, peeling paint or finish, loose or sagging trim, and gaps between the trim and the wall or door frame. These problems not only affect the aesthetic appeal but can also lead to drafts, reduced energy efficiency, or difficulty opening and closing doors. Addressing these issues promptly helps prevent further damage and maintains the overall integrity of the interior space.

The overview below groups typical Interior Door Trim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or interior door trim repairs generally range from $100 to $300. Many routine touch-ups or small fixes fall within this band, though prices can vary based on materials and local rates.
Moderate Projects - replacing or repairing multiple door trims usually costs between $250 and $600 for most homeowners. These projects often involve standard materials and straightforward installation, with fewer jobs reaching higher prices.
Large or Complex Repairs - extensive repairs or custom trim work can range from $600 to $1,500. Such projects may include intricate detailing or matching existing trim, which can increase costs depending on scope and materials.
Full Replacement - complete interior door trim replacement can cost $1,000 to $3,000 or more for larger, more detailed projects. While many projects stay within the middle range, larger or more intricate jobs can push costs higher depending on the complexity involved.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
